NEXT FUNDS Thai Stock SET50 ETF (Ticker: JP:1559) offers investors a unique opportunity to tap into the dynamic growth potential of Thailand's top-performing companies. This Exchange Traded Fund (ETF) is meticulously designed to track the performance of the SET50 Index, which comprises the 50 largest and most liquid stocks on the Stock Exchange of Thailand. By focusing on this index, NEXT FUNDS Thai Stock SET50 ETF provides comprehensive exposure to the Thai equity market, capturing both the breadth and depth of its economic landscape.
